    How AI is Changing Online Poker

    AI has had a profound impact on the world of online poker. It has allowed players to use sophisticated algorithms to analyze their opponents’ behavior and create strategies that give them an edge in real money games. In addition, this data can be used to identify patterns in opponents’ betting habits, giving players an advantage over those who don’t have access to such information.

    In addition, AI-powered bots have been developed that can beat even professional poker players at two-person games like Texas Hold ’em. To play poker online, these bots use deep learning techniques to analyze past hands and make decisions based on probability rather than intuition or experience. Unfortunately, this makes them incredibly difficult to beat, even for experienced players.

    Ensuring Fair Play

    The rise of AI in online poker raises serious concerns about fairness and security. To combat these issues, many sites have implemented measures such as monitoring software and anti-cheating protocols that detect suspicious activity from bots or other forms of cheating. Additionally, some sites offer special tournaments where only human players are allowed, ensuring a level playing field for all participants.

    In addition, some sites have begun using chatbots powered by natural language processing (NLP) technology to help players improve their game by providing advice on strategy and tactics based on their past performance. These chatbots are designed to simulate human conversation to provide personalized feedback without disrupting the game’s flow.
